Size Reduction and Energy Requirement - ScienceDirect
2016-1-1 For size reduction of ore in a closed circuit reduction process, Bond derived the specific energy for grinding as (3.3) E G = 10 W i 1 P − 1 F kWh / t. Equation is the result of fundamental work by Bond. It has now been accepted universally.

Energy Use of Fine Grinding in Mineral Processing ...
2013-12-18 Energy Use in Comminution. Grinding activities in general (including coarse, intermediate, and fine grinding) account for 0.5 pct of U.S. primary energy use, 3.8 pct of total U.S. electricity consumption, and 40 pct of total U.S. mining industry energy use. Large energy saving opportunities have been identified in grinding in particular.

CHAPTER 11 SIZE REDUCTION - NZIFST
2019-2-24 where dE is the differential energy required, dL is the change in a typical dimension, L is the magnitude of a typical length dimension and K, n, are constants. Kick assumed that the energy required to reduce a material in size was directly proportional to the size reduction ratio dL/L. This implies that n in eqn. (11.1) is equal to -1. If K ...
